UltraISO.CCD.Buffer.Overflow

Last Updated DateApr 08, 2010
Release DateJun 17, 2009
SeverityCritical
ImpactSystem Compromise: Remote attackers can gain control of vulnerable systems.
DescriptionThis indicates an attack attempt against a buffer-overflow vulnerability in UltraISO.

The vulnerability is caused by an error when the vulnerable software handles a malicious .ccd or .img file. It all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code via sending a crafted .ccd or .img file.
Affected ProductsUltraISO 9.3.3.2685 and earlier
Recommended ActionsDo not open untrusted image files.
